Fiber Grade Titanium Dioxide: A Specs & Certification Guide for Polyester, Nylon, and Viscose Fibers

Fiber grade titanium dioxide SA-50 sample for PET fiber whitening

Fiber grade titanium dioxide is a specialized anatase pigment designed for the delustering, whitening, and matting of synthetic and regenerated fibers. Unlike pigment-grade TiO₂ used in paints or coatings, fiber grade must meet stringent purity, dispersion, and thermal stability requirements to avoid spinneret clogging, filament breakage, and yellowing during high-temperature spinning. As the global fiber grade TiO₂ market reaches approximately USD 1.46 billion in 2024 and is projected to grow to USD 1.94 billion by 2032 (Intel Market Research), selecting the right product becomes critical for textile manufacturers aiming to balance quality and cost.

Why Fiber Grade TiO₂ Matters in Textile Production

In polyester, nylon, viscose, and acrylic fiber manufacturing, titanium dioxide acts as a matting agent to control luster and as a whitening agent to achieve high brightness. The anatase crystalline form is preferred over rutile because its lower Mohs hardness (5.5–6.0 vs. 6.0–7.0) reduces wear on spinneret nozzles and extends production runs. However, even small amounts of iron impurities or ionic residues can catalyze side reactions, degrade polymer intrinsic viscosity, or cause yellowing. These challenges directly affect production efficiency, fiber quality, and dyeing consistency—making the choice of TiO₂ a constraint-driven purchasing decision.

Product Range: SA-50, SA-60, SA-80

ORIENT INTERNATIONAL offers three main anatase fiber grade titanium dioxide models, each formulated for a specific fiber type:

Model Application TiO₂ Content Fe₂O₃ pH Value Key Feature
SA-50 Polyester (PET) – continuous spinning, recycled PET ≥98.0% ≤0.004% 6.8±0.2 Low ionic impurities, neutral pH, stable at 240–285°C, SSA 8.5–10.0 m²/g
SA-60 Viscose & Acrylic fiber ≥97.0% ≤0.004% 7.2±0.6 Matting, consistent L value ≥96.5
SA-80 Nylon (Polyamide) ≥95.0% ≤0.004% 6.8–8.0 Low conductivity (≤100 μs/cm), extremely fine sieve residue

Step-by-Step: Using SA-50 in Polyester Production

The successful application of fiber grade TiO₂ in PET manufacturing relies on pre-dispersion and stable dosing. Based on documented best practices for SA-50:

  1. Dispersion in ethylene glycol (EG): SA-50 is added to warm EG (40–60°C) with gentle stirring to form a stable suspension without sedimentation or agglomeration. A closed vacuum feeding system is recommended to prevent moisture pickup.
  2. Injection into esterification reactor: The suspension is metered into the PET reactor during the esterification or polycondensation stage at temperatures of 240–285°C. SA-50’s neutral pH and low ionic impurities (Fe₂O₃ ≤0.004%) ensure that the polymer’s intrinsic viscosity (IV) is not degraded and no black specks or side reactions occur.
  3. Continuous spinning: The well-dispersed anatase particles remain uniformly distributed in the molten polymer, preventing spinneret clogging and filament breakage. In field use, average spinneret life extension exceeds 40% and filament breakage rate drops by about 35% compared to less stable grades.
  4. Finished fiber quality: The resulting PET fibers exhibit stable whiteness (L value >96.7, b value ≤0.0), uniform matting, and consistent dyeing with no streaks. The particles adhere firmly to the fiber matrix, resisting dust-off during weaving and finishing.

2. What are the key technical parameters of SA-50 for PET fibers?

SA-50 is an anatase grade with TiO₂ content ≥98.0%, Fe₂O₃ ≤0.004%, pH 6.8±0.2, electrical conductivity ≤230 μs/cm, specific surface area 8.5–10.0 m²/g, and color L value 96.7–98.2 / b value ≤0.0. These parameters ensure low impurity, neutral pH, and high dispersion stability in ethylene glycol at polymerization temperatures.
